Duties
and responsibilities
|
Oversee adherence to
quality standards and safety procedures by the commissioning team, ensuring
compliance with work permit protocols. Conduct thorough reviews of
pre-commissioning and commissioning procedures for all rotary, reciprocating,
static equipment & packages. Develop or refine
inspection forms tailored to the pre-commissioning and commissioning
activities related to mechanical disciplines. Collaborate with
supervisors to define detailed procedures, ensuring comprehensive coverage of
all mechanical discipline activities. In alignment with the
general pre-commissioning schedule, devise detailed plans for all mechanical
components. Establish daily activities
and develop a meticulous day-by-day plan, prioritizing tasks in agreement
with the Commissioning Superintendent. Monitor the execution of
all pre-commissioning and commissioning activities, confirming adherence to
established procedures and schedules. Delegate tasks effectively
to supervisors and assistants. Support the CMS and work in
tandem with the other Commissioning discipline Superintendents (electrical,
instrument) to finalize pre-commissioning and commissioning activities,
facilitating a seamless project handover within the agreed timelines with the
Commissioning Manager. Regularly report on
progress and maintain up to date records of activities. Serve as the liaison among
the Client Project Team, Project Management, Subcontractors, Vendors
Representatives. Recommend vendors
specialist mobilizations to the Commissioning Manager and CVC, overseeing and
coordinating vendor-required site activities. Provide support to Vendor
specialists during job execution and coordinate their actions with
Commissioning supervisors. Ensure the availability of
commissioning spares and consumables necessary for activity execution. Assist the QA Site team in
compiling handover system dossiers, including all required certifications, in
accordance with the Inspection Test Plan and certification matrix. Coordinate and supervise
Construction support activities during the pre-commissioning and
commissioning phases. Act as the authorized
person designated by the site manager to issue or receive a Permit to Work in
line with the project’s Permit to Work Procedure.
